It abstracts everything, making it feel like a typical C/S environment.  It supports Java, ObjectPascal, BASIC, and C syntax for the high-level code you write, plus you can drop widgets in from other frameworks to customize  it.  Then on top of that it builds the web pages, the web server, and the database server for you, so all you do is work on the actual application.  All the lower level things are done automatically.&lt;BR/&gt;&lt;BR/&gt;While I like using some of the other tools you mentioned, especially Aptana, it isn't a RAD tool.
